High-Spatial-Resolution Dynamic Strain Measurement Based on Brillouin Optical Correlation-Domain Sensors

Yahui Wang,
Jing Chen,
Jinglian Ma
et al.

Abstract: Brillouin-scattering-based sensors have been widely applied in distributed temperature or strain measurement in recent 20 years. Brillouin optical correlation-domain technology has extensive development and application prospects because of its millimeter-level spatial resolution, distribution measurement, and high accuracy. Traditional Brillouin-scattering-based sensors, requiring a time-consuming frequency-sweep process, struggle to achieve dynamic strain measurement.
